

Thusnelda Victoria Woodhouse
Williamsburg, Va. – Thusnelda Victoria Woodhouse, 83 passed away on Monday June 9, 2025.
Mrs. Woodhouse, known to friends and family as ‘Nelda’ was a native of Panama and a resident of Williamsburg, for 25 years. Her working career began in the medical field and she retired from a successful sales career with JCPenney.
She was preceded in death by her parents, husband and a brother. She is survived by her daughter Dafney Lorane Romanick and her husband Colin.
A memorial mass will be celebrated on Tuesday June 17, 2025 at 9:00 AM in St. Bede’s Catholic Church internment will follow in the church columbarium. Arrangements are by Amory Funeral Home, Grafton, Va.
The Prophet on Relationship
By Kahlil Gibran
And he said: You were born together, and together you shall be forevermore. You shall be together when the white wings of death scatter your days. Ay, you shall be together even in the silent memory of God. But let there be spaces in your togetherness, And let the winds of heavens dance between you. Love one another, but make not a bond of love: Let it rather be a moving sea between the shores of your souls. Fill each other’s cup but drink not from one cup. Give one another of your bread but eat not from the same loaf. Sing and dance together and be joyous, but let each one of you be alone. Even as the strings of a lute are alone though they quiver with the same music. Give your hearts, but not into each other’s keeping. For only the hands of Life can contain your hearts. And stand together yet not too near together: For the pillars of the temple stand apart, And the oak tree and the cypress grow not in each other’s shadow.
